作为一家专业的的设计外包公司,为各大品牌提供包装设计,VI设计,海报设计,详情页设计等各种设计服务!您只需要提供需求,剩下的我们来实现! SVG交互实现方案,企业官网SVG交互设计,电商平台图标SVG交互实现,SVG交互18402890810
广告设计公司 高端高创意高水平
发布时间 2026-05-08 SVG交互

  在当今的网页设计领域,用户对动态视觉体验的需求正以前所未有的速度增长。无论是复杂的动画引导、响应式的图标交互,还是触控设备上的流畅反馈,都要求设计师和开发者具备更精细的控制能力。在这样的背景下,SVG交互逐渐成为实现高质量视觉效果的核心技术之一。它不仅能够提供清晰的矢量图形表现,还能通过事件绑定与动画过渡实现丰富的用户互动,为页面注入生命力。相比传统的位图图像,SVG在缩放、加载性能和可维护性方面具有显著优势,尤其适合现代多端适配的设计需求。

  为什么SVG交互如此重要?

  从用户体验的角度来看,动态元素能有效提升用户的参与感与停留时间。当一个按钮在悬停时产生微妙的形变,或是一个图标在点击后展开子菜单,这些微小但精准的反馈,都在无声中建立信任与愉悦。而这一切,正是基于SVG交互实现的。更重要的是,由于SVG是基于文本的矢量格式,其文件体积通常远小于同等质量的PNG或JPEG,尤其在高分辨率屏幕普及的今天,这一点显得尤为关键。结合CSS和JavaScript的灵活控制,开发者可以轻松实现按需加载、渐进式增强等优化策略,从而在不牺牲视觉效果的前提下大幅提升页面加载效率。

  SVG交互

  核心概念解析:理解基础才能驾驭复杂

  要真正掌握SVG交互,首先需要理解几个关键概念。首先是“矢量图形”——这意味着图像由路径、形状和颜色定义,而非像素点构成,因此无论放大多少倍都不会失真。其次是“事件绑定”,即通过addEventListener等机制,将用户的操作(如click、mouseover)与特定的SVG元素关联,触发相应的逻辑或动画。最后是“动画过渡”,利用CSS transition、animation或SMIL(虽已逐步被弃用),实现平滑的视觉变化。这些概念看似简单,但在实际项目中组合运用时,往往考验着开发者的整体架构思维。

  当前主流实践:从布局集成到触控适配

  如今,许多前端框架(如React、Vue)已支持SVG组件化开发,开发者可以通过JSX或模板语法直接嵌入SVG代码,并赋予其类名与事件处理函数。在响应式设计中,将SVG作为图标库使用已成为标准做法,配合媒体查询和flex/grid布局,确保在不同设备上保持一致的视觉表现。而在移动端,触控操作的适配同样不容忽视。通过合理设置touch-action、debounce事件处理以及避免过长的动画周期,可以有效防止误触与卡顿,提升移动用户的操作流畅度。

  通用方法:渐进式增强与可访问性并重

  面对日益复杂的交互需求,一套稳健的方法论必不可少。推荐采用“渐进式增强”策略:先保证基础功能在所有环境下可用,再逐步添加高级交互效果。例如,一个导航图标应至少在无JS环境下显示正常,仅在支持脚本的环境中才启用悬停动画。同时,可访问性(Accessibility)也必须纳入考量——为关键交互元素添加aria-label、role属性,并确保键盘导航的完整性,让残障用户也能顺畅使用。这不仅是技术规范,更是设计责任。

  创新策略:基于CSS-in-JS的动态样式控制

  传统方式中,样式与逻辑分离不清,导致大量重复代码和维护成本上升。为此,引入基于CSS-in-JS的动态样式控制是一种值得尝试的创新路径。通过在JS中直接定义样式规则,结合状态变量动态调整,可以实现更细粒度的交互控制。例如,根据用户行为实时改变图标颜色、大小或旋转角度,且无需额外的CSS类切换。这种方式不仅提升了代码的可读性与复用性,还使样式变更更加直观可控,特别适用于高度动态的界面组件。

  常见问题与解决建议

  尽管SVG交互优势明显,但在实践中仍存在不少挑战。最典型的问题包括代码冗余、跨浏览器兼容性差异以及调试困难。针对这些问题,建议采用模块化组件封装的方式,将常用的交互逻辑(如按钮悬停、菜单展开)抽象为独立的SVG组件,统一管理状态与事件。此外,引入自动化测试流程,如使用Jest或Cypress对交互行为进行断言验证,能够有效降低回归风险。同时,借助工具如SVGO进行压缩优化,进一步减小资源体积。

  预期成果与未来影响

  当上述方法被系统性地应用后,最终将带来更流畅的用户交互体验与更高的页面加载效率。页面不再只是静态信息的堆砌,而成为一个有回应、有节奏的数字空间。这种转变不仅提升了品牌形象,也增强了用户粘性。长远来看,随着Web 3.0与沉浸式交互的兴起,具备丰富交互能力的矢量图形将成为构建下一代网页应用的重要基石。掌握SVG交互,意味着站在了前端技术演进的前沿。

  我们专注于前端交互设计与高性能页面开发,长期服务于各类品牌官网、电商平台及企业级系统,擅长将SVG交互与业务逻辑深度融合,打造既美观又高效的用户体验。团队成员均具备多年实战经验,熟悉主流框架与性能优化手段,能够快速响应项目需求,确保交付质量。如果您正在寻找可靠的前端解决方案,欢迎随时联系,微信同号18140119082。

SVG交互实现方案,企业官网SVG交互设计,电商平台图标SVG交互实现,SVG交互